GLP-1 exerts its effects through several key mechanisms: Glucose-dependent insulin secretion : GLP-1 stimulates pancreatic beta cells to release insulin, but only when blood glucose levels are elevated, reducing the risk of hypoglycaemia Glucagon suppression : It inhibits the release of glucagon from pancreatic alpha cells, thereby reducing hepatic glucose production Delayed gastric emptying : GLP-1 slows the rate at which food leaves the stomach, leading to more gradual glucose absorption and increased satiety Appetite regulation : Acting on brain centres, GLP-1 promotes feelings of fullness and reduces food intake Prescription GLP-1 receptor agonists (such as semaglutide, dulaglutide, and liraglutide) are synthetic analogues designed to mimic and enhance these natural effects
